UAE Launches Winter Tourism Season With Events Nationwide

The UAE has officially launched its winter tourism season, attracting visitors with milder weather and diverse experiences across all emirates. From mid-December to April, tourists can enjoy outdoor activities, heritage festivals, winter camps, and entertainment shows. The Liwa International Festival in Abu Dhabi’s Al Dhafra Region is one of the key events, running from 12th December to 3rd January, featuring desert sports, artistic performances, music, and shopping zones that highlight Emirati heritage.

Abu Dhabi also offers family-friendly programmes at Umm Al Emarat Park, continuing until April 2026. Yas Island hosts snow-themed experiences, festive celebrations, and the ten-day Yas Winter Festival from 12th to 21st December. Dubai attracts visitors with Global Village, Dubai Shopping Festival, drone shows, Winter City at Expo City Dubai, and Winter District activities running through April. Hatta holds the Hatta Winter Festival from 5th to 28th December, combining mountain adventures, eco-tours, heritage markets, and cultural workshops.

Sharjah, Ajman, Umm Al Qaiwain, Fujairah, and Ras Al Khaimah also offer winter events, including light shows, cultural markets, winter camps, and beach and mountain activities, catering to families and nature lovers. Al Ain stands out with heritage programmes, oasis visits, museum events, safaris, and mountain adventures on Jebel Hafeet. Winter camps in Abu Dhabi, Dubai, and Ras Al Khaimah focus on youth development in arts, sports, technology, and environmental challenges, making the season entertaining and educational.

The UAE’s winter season continues to strengthen its position as a top global tourist destination, combining culture, adventure, and family-friendly activities for residents and international visitors alike.
